Default Hulu's SOLAR OPPOSITES (in development)


Online streamer Hulu, which is soon to be majority-owned by the Walt Disney Company, has ordered 16 episodes of Solar Opposites, an animated series created by Rick & Morty co-creator Justin Roiland and Rick & Morty story editor/supervising producer Mike McMahan.

20th Century Fox TV, also soon to be owned by Disney, will produce the episodes, which will be spread out over two seasons. The show is slated for a 2020 premiere.

Solar Opposites follows a family of aliens who leave their planet and settle in suburban America. Roiland will lead the voice cast as Terry and Korvo (see character line-up below), while Sean Giambrone voices Yumyulack and Mary Mack is Jesse. Roiland and McMahan will do double-duty, continuing their roles on Rick & Morty, which recently picked up an unprecedented 70-episode order from Adult Swim.

In 2015, Roiland shared development art from Solar Opposties on Twitter. It’s likely that the show has evolved its visual appearance since then, but here are some examples of what the project looked like a few years ago.
